Malik Akowuah praises Hearts supporters

Hearts of Oak enterprising midfielder Malik Akowuah has thanked the club’s fans for their unflinching support in their 1-1 away draw game with Ebusua Dwarfs on match day three of the ongoing Ghana Premier League on Wednesday.

The Phobians took the lead in the 9th minute after Patrick Razak finished off a through pass from Cosmos Dauda.
The Accra giants then left their foot off the paddle – allowing Dwarfs to take control of the game and two minutes after the break Nicholas Gyan pulled even for the Cape Coast based club.

“It wasn’t an easy game we did what we have to do, I must thank our supporters they came to Cape Coast in their numbers,” Akowuah said after the game.

“In our first game against Inter Allies it was Monday but they were there to support us, I want them to continue with that support and we will make sure we put smiles on their faces,” he added.
